[Stacomir-commits] r304 - in pkg: stacomir/R stacomirtools/R

noreply at r-forge.r-project.org noreply at r-forge.r-project.org
Thu Mar 16 10:34:57 CET 2017


Author: briand
Date: 2017-03-16 10:34:57 +0100 (Thu, 16 Mar 2017)
New Revision: 304

Modified:
   pkg/stacomir/R/BilanMigrationMult.r
   pkg/stacomirtools/R/RequeteODBCwheredate.r
Log:


Modified: pkg/stacomir/R/BilanMigrationMult.r
===================================================================
--- pkg/stacomir/R/BilanMigrationMult.r	2017-03-16 09:00:49 UTC (rev 303)
+++ pkg/stacomir/R/BilanMigrationMult.r	2017-03-16 09:34:57 UTC (rev 304)
@@ -276,8 +276,8 @@
 			req at colonnedebut<-"ope_date_debut"
 			req at colonnefin<-"ope_date_fin"
 			# we round the date to be consistent with daily values from the 
-			req at datedebut=as.POSIXlt(as.Date(bilanMigrationMult at pasDeTemps@dateDebut,tz=Sys.timezone()))
-			req at datefin=as.POSIXlt(as.Date(DateFin(bilanMigrationMult at pasDeTemps),tz=Sys.timezone()))
+			req at datedebut=bilanMigrationMult at pasDeTemps@dateDebut
+			req at datefin=as.POSIXlt(DateFin(bilanMigrationMult at pasDeTemps)+as.difftime("23:59:59"))
 			dc = vector_to_listsql(bilanMigrationMult at dc@dc_selectionne)
 			tax=vector_to_listsql(bilanMigrationMult at taxons@data$tax_code)
 			std=vector_to_listsql(bilanMigrationMult at stades@data$std_code)

Modified: pkg/stacomirtools/R/RequeteODBCwheredate.r
===================================================================
--- pkg/stacomirtools/R/RequeteODBCwheredate.r	2017-03-16 09:00:49 UTC (rev 303)
+++ pkg/stacomirtools/R/RequeteODBCwheredate.r	2017-03-16 09:34:57 UTC (rev 304)
@@ -28,8 +28,8 @@
 			requeteODBCwhere=new("RequeteODBCwhere")
 			requeteODBCwhere at where=paste("WHERE (",from at colonnedebut,
 					", ",from at colonnefin,
-					") overlaps (DATE '",
-					from at datedebut,"',DATE '",
+					") overlaps (timestamp without time zone '",
+					from at datedebut,"',timestamp without time zone '",
 					from at datefin,"') ")
 			requeteODBCwhere at and=paste(from at and,sep=" ") # concatenation du vecteur
 			requeteODBCwhere at select=from at select



More information about the Stacomir-commits mailing list